Understanding Guardianship and Conservatorship

Guardianship typically applies to minors or individuals who cannot care for themselves due to age or disability. Conservatorship, on the other hand, usually involves adults who are unable to handle financial or legal matters. Courts require detailed documentation for both arrangements, including petitions, affidavits, and declarations.

Because these documents grant significant authority, it’s crucial that every signature is verified and properly executed. Notarization provides that verification and ensures that the documents meet legal standards.

Why Notarization Matters

A notary public serves as an impartial witness to the signing of documents. In guardianship and conservatorship cases, notarization offers several benefits:

  1. Verifies identity: Confirms that the individual signing the documents is who they claim to be.
  2. Prevents fraud: Reduces the risk of unauthorized or forged signatures.
  3. Supports legal validity: Courts are more likely to accept notarized documents without question.
  4. Provides peace of mind: Ensures all parties that the paperwork has been completed correctly and professionally.

Notarization does not replace legal counsel, but it is a critical component of the process, making the documents enforceable and recognized by courts.

Common Documents That Require Notarization

Guardianship and conservatorship cases involve several types of documents that often require notarization:

  • Petition for Guardianship or Conservatorship: The formal request submitted to the court.
  • Consent Forms: When other family members or parties need to agree to the arrangement.
  • Affidavits or Declarations: Statements verifying information relevant to the petition.
  • Court Forms: Additional supporting documentation required by local courts.

Having a notary witness these documents ensures that signatures are valid and reduces the likelihood of the court requesting corrections or additional verification.

Tips for a Smooth Notary Appointment

To make your visit quick and stress-free:

  • Do not sign ahead of time: Signatures must occur in the presence of the notary.
  • Bring all necessary parties and witnesses: Some documents may require multiple signers or witnesses.
  • Confirm required forms: Check with the court to ensure all necessary documentation is included.
  • Ask questions about the process: Notaries cannot give legal advice, but they can explain notarization procedures.
  • Schedule ahead if needed: Especially for complex cases or multiple documents, planning can save time.
